Sharmaji Ki Beti: The Epitome of Excellence and Societal Expectations

Introduction

In the tapestry of Indian society, the figure of Sharmaji Ki Beti stands tall, embodying an archetype of success, virtue, and societal expectations. This moniker, often used humorously, refers to the idealized daughter who consistently excels in all spheres of life, from academics to extracurriculars, leaving her peers in awe and her parents bursting with pride. While this image may elicit a chuckle, it also serves as a reflection of the immense pressure and expectations placed on young women within the Indian cultural context.

The expectations surrounding Sharmaji Ki Beti are not merely confined to her academic achievements but extend to every aspect of her being. She is expected to be the perfect daughter, obedient, respectful, and possessing an impeccable moral character. She is expected to be a flawless housekeeper, an expert cook, and a nurturing mother. The pressure to live up to these unattainable standards can weigh heavily on young women, leading to feelings of inadequacy and self-doubt.
